Appendix A Default Configuration Settings and Technical Specifications Default Configuration Settings The following table lists the default settings of your Product Family. Feature Description Smart Wizard Wireless Wireless Communication Wireless Network Name (SSID) Security Enabled Enabled Any (first available network) Disabled Network Type Infrastructure Transmission Speed Autoa Country/Region United States (varies by region) Operating Mode g and b, up to 130 Mbps, g only up to 270 Mbps Data Rate up to 270 Mbps a. Maximum wireless signal rate (IEEE Standard 802.11n draft specification). Actual throughput will vary. Network conditions and environmental factors, including volume of network traffic, building materials and construction, and network overhead, lower actual data throughput rate.
